Australia - Import of Hot Formed Bar and Rod of Iron or Non-Alloy Steel Containing by Weight 0.25% or Less of Carbon

Since 2014, Australia Import of Hot Formed Bar and Rod of Iron or Non-Alloy Steel Containing by Weight 0.25% or Less of Carbon decreased by 15.8%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 48 among other countries in Import of Hot Formed Bar and Rod of Iron or Non-Alloy Steel Containing by Weight 0.25% or Less of Carbon with $19,142,833.82. Australia is overtaken by Croatia, which was number 47 with $21,362,410.43 and is followed by Peru with $18,421,432.82. Germany lead the ranking with $682,674,462.3 in 2019, a decrease of 6.9% compared to 2018. France, Thailand and United States resp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Gambia recorded the best 5 years average growth at +176.5% per year, while Panama was the worst growing country at -64.5% per year.
